Official abstract text for this publication.
The present invention relates to an ink-jet printing method that is capable of obtaining good printed materials that are free of occurrence of color migration and deformation of a printing medium even when printed on a transparent resin printing medium using a water-based ink containing a white ink, and a black or chromatic ink. The present invention provides an ink-jet printing method including the step of ejecting a water-based ink onto a printing medium using a printing apparatus to print characters or images on the printing medium, said printing apparatus including an ink-jet printing head that ejects the water-based ink onto the printing medium that is transported in a feeding direction thereof; and an drying mechanism that is disposed on a downstream side in a feeding direction of the printing medium, in which the printing medium is in the form of a transparent resin printing medium, and the water-based ink includes a white ink, and a black or chromatic ink, and in which the drying mechanism blows a superheated steam that is heated to a temperature of 100 to 180° C. onto at least one of a printing surface and an opposite surface of the printing medium.

The invention claimed is: 1. An ink-jet printing method comprising the step of ejecting a water-based ink onto a printing medium using a printing apparatus to print characters or images on the printing medium, said printing apparatus comprising an ink-jet printing head that ejects the water-based ink onto the printing medium that is transported in a feeding direction thereof; and a drying mechanism that is disposed on a downstream side in a feeding direction of the printing medium, in which the printing medium is in the form of a transparent resin printing medium, and a temperature of a surface of the printing medium upon printing is in the range 35° C. through 75° C., and the water-based ink comprises a white ink, and a black or chromatic ink, and in which a superheated steam injection nozzle is disposed such that a tip end thereof is spaced at a distance 10 mm through 300 mm apart from the surface of the printing medium, and the drying mechanism blows a superheated steam that is heated to a temperature of not lower than 100° C. and not higher than 148° C. against at least one of a printing surface and an opposite surface of the printing medium. 2. The ink-jet printing method according to claim 1 , wherein a content of an organic solvent having a boiling point of not lower than 90° C. and lower than 250° C. in the black or chromatic water-based ink is not less than 15% by mass and not more than 35% by mass. 3. The ink-jet printing method according to claim 1 , wherein the printing medium is a polyester film that is subjected to corona discharge treatment, or a stretched polypropylene film. 4. The ink-jet printing method according to claim 1 , wherein a thickness of the printing medium is not less than 1 μm and not more than 100 μm. 5. The ink-jet printing method according to claim 1 , wherein a temperature of the ink-jet printing head is not lower than 20° C. and not higher than 45° C. 6. The ink-jet printing method according to claim 1 , wherein an amount of droplets of the water-based ink ejected is not more than 20 pL. 7. The ink-jet printing method according to claim 1 , wherein a printing speed in terms of a transportation speed of the printing medium is not less than 20 m/min.
